The phrase "alignment converts" is grammatically correct and can be used in written English.
It can be used in contexts discussing how alignment leads to a transformation or change in a particular state or condition.
Example: "In our study, we found that proper alignment converts the initial chaos into a structured workflow."
Alternatives: "alignment transforms" or "alignment changes".
